Traveling abroad this summer?  Interested in other cultures?  Or writing a paper for an international business class?  Regardless of whether you have business or pleasure in mind, if you need to research other countries, this new resource may be for you.  Global Road Warrior Country Database is a guide for companies and individuals traveling to or doing business in foreign countries. Covering 175 countries, Global Road Warrior Country Database addresses 22 categories of interest to travelers, including business culture, communications, demographics, money and banking, points of interest, security, society and culture, tips for businesswomen, transportation, and travel essentials. It also includes maps and photographs.  Connect to this database at:  http://media.lib.ecu.edu/erdbs/erdbs_description.cfm?id=501

Sculpture Exhibit now on Display

April 1st, 2008
Joyner Library is proud to present the sculptures of Hanna Jubran, Reflection on Nature: One-Hundred Works, currently on display on the second floor of the library. Professor Jubran was graduated from the University of Wisconsin, Milwaukee with a Bachelor of Fine Arts in 1980 and later received a Masters of Fine Arts in sculpture in 1983. He has served as a faculty member of ECU s School of Art and Design since 1994, where he serves as a professor of art-sculpture. Jubran s works have been exhibited throughout North America, Europe, the Middle East, and Latin and South America. The exhibit kicked off with an opening ceremony on Thursday, March 27 and will run through June 27, 2008. The exhibit is viewable during normal library hours.

New Database: Roper Center iPOLL

March 17th, 2008

Roper Center iPOLL, from the Roper Center for Public Opinion Research, is a full text database of 500,000 questions from national public opinion surveys since 1935 and updated daily. iPOLL includes survey results data from academic, commercial and media survey organizations such as Gallup, Harris Interactive, Pew Research Associates, ABC, CBS, Wall Street Journal and many more. Many data sets are available for download in ASCII or SPSS format through RoperExpress.
